Important Topics:
- Anthropic Warns of Self-Improving AI: Anthropic publishes data showing that over 80% of its internal code merges are Claude-authored, warning that recursive self-improvement could arrive before institutions are structurally prepared.
- Bots Outnumber Humans Online: Cloudflare confirms that automated traffic has inverted the web, with AI agents and web crawlers accounting for 57.5% of total internet activity, leaving human traffic at 42.5%.
- The Death of Tokenmaxxing: Enterprise buyers scale back flagrant token expenditures, forcing platforms like Snowflake and Microsoft to launch hyper-efficient, smaller reasoning models and local hardware tools like the Surface Ultra.
- ChatGPT Overhauls Memory with "Dreaming": OpenAI introduces a continuous background optimization engine that transforms disjointed memory facts into a structured, evolving profile of user data.
- AI Leaders Group Against Bioweapons: CEOs from OpenAI, Anthropic, DeepMind, and Microsoft sign an open letter pushing Congress to mandate strict customer verification for synthetic DNA and RNA providers.
- U.S. Explores AI Ownership Stakes: The federal government enters preliminary discussions regarding voluntary equity distribution from top AI labs, potentially routing proceeds into a household public dividend.
- Alibaba Launches Closed Qwen3.7-Max: Alibaba debuts its smartest closed-weight reasoning model, achieving a highly controlled 23% hallucination rate by intentionally declining to answer more than half of its prompts.
- Meta Hides Biometric Code in Glasses App: Code analysis reveals Meta has embedded un-activated facial recognition, face-cropping, and biometric encoding models into its smart glasses companion software.
